Upcoming events for senior citizens offered
The City of Dearborn’s Senior Services Division – part
of the Dearborn Recreation Department – is offering the following
events for senior citizens.
Except where otherwise noted, they will be held in the senior citizen
services area of Dearborn’s Ford Community & Performing
Arts Center, 15801 Michigan Avenue (corner of Michigan and Greenfield
Road).
Pack Your Bag: Free Medication Consultation –
Sign up for a one-on-one consultation with a local CVS pharmacist
on Tuesday, July 22, at 10 a.m. The consultant will give tips and
tools for medication compliance, help identify duplicate and outdated
prescriptions or over the counter medications and answer questions
on prescription and non-prescription medications. Remember to bring
all your medications. Pack Your Bag events are sponsored by the National
Council on Aging. Please pre-register to attend this event by calling
313.943.2412.

Dearborn Senior Walking Club – Walk your way to good
health. The Dearborn Senior Walking Club meets every Monday,
Wednesday and Friday at The Center’s indoor running track. Check-in
is from 1 to 1:30 p.m. Walk the track from 1:30 to 3 p.m. Members
set personal goals and record mileage. Membership is open to Dearborn
senior citizens. Members who are not Center passholders pay $1 per
visit. Members who are Center passholders walk for free. For more
information, call 943.2412.
Blood Pressure, Cholesterol and Glucose Checks – The
City of Dearborn Health Department nurse offers free blood pressure
check for seniors every Thursday from 9-11 a.m. Cholesterol and glucose
checks are available for a fee of $5 each. For more information, call
313.943.2412
